adrenocorticotropic hormone

/əˌˈdrinoʊˈkɔrdəkoʊˌtrɑfɪk ˌhɔrˈmoʊn/
IPA guide

Definitions of adrenocorticotropic hormone
  1. noun
    a hormone produced by the anterior pituitary gland that stimulates the adrenal cortex
    see moresee less
    type of:
    endocrine, hormone, internal secretion
    the secretion of an endocrine gland that is transmitted by the blood to the tissue on which it has a specific effect
